> Since TEZ-4236 (in Tez 0.10.1), tez local mode can run without even starting
> an RPC server in the DAGAppMaster, which is in the same JVM as the client.
> Adapting tez.local.mode.without.network=true could make tez.local.mode=true
> unit tests more stable.
